Remove
Pronunciation: /riːˈmuːv/
Remove (verb)
- To take something away from a place or position.
- To get rid of something unwanted or unnecessary.
- To make someone leave their job or position.
Examples
- Please remove the books from the table.
- She removed the old wallpaper easily.
Common collocations: remove a stain, remove obstacles, remove from the list, remove a threat, remove barriers
